Description:
The unique physical, optical, and electronic characteristics of novel optical materials are the objects of intense research and applications in optical communication, signal and image processing, and information storage. Until now, however, no single reference offered an up-to-date treatment of the major classes of these materials and their applications in nonlinear optics, integrated optics, electro-optics, optical storage, and information processing. Novel Optical Materials and Applications fills that gap with timely contributions from leading authorities in virtually every subdiscipline of the field. Several of the discussions treat new or emerging applications developed for materials already widely used in other applications, including semiconductors, liquid crystals, polymers, photorefractive crystals, and other specially engineered materials. The discussion of semiconductors focuses on nanostructures and quantized structures, which possess very high density optoelectronics data- and signal-processing capabilities. They also enable the creation of ever more efficient and broad spectral range lasers and optoelectronics devices. The many applications of liquid crystals have lately been expanded by the discovery of both new material systems and new phenomena. The new systems/phenomena discussed here include dye-doped liquid crystals and waveguide structures. Polymeric materials are viewed in the light of their electro-optical and nonlinear optical properties, which have been exploited in the latest achievements in ultrafast devices for optical modulations and efficient wavelength conversion processes and structures. The emphasis in the discussion of photorefractive materials is onapplications in ultrahigh density optical phase conjugation, holographic storage, optical computing, and neural networks.
